Market Overview and Evolution of Pain Management in Japan
Japan’s healthcare sector is one of the most advanced in the world, with a strong emphasis on innovation, patient care, and technological advancements. The market for minimally invasive pain management devices in Japan has been steadily expanding, driven by the rising geriatric population, increasing prevalence of chronic pain conditions, and the growing preference for non-surgical treatment options. With a rapidly aging society, Japan faces a higher burden of musculoskeletal disorders, neuropathic pain, and post-surgical pain, all of which contribute to the demand for effective pain management solutions.
Minimally invasive pain management devices, including nerve stimulators, radiofrequency ablation devices, and drug delivery systems, are gaining popularity due to their ability to provide targeted pain relief with fewer complications and shorter recovery times. The Japanese government has been actively promoting advanced medical technologies, further supporting the growth of this market. Demand Drivers and Market Growth Factors
The demand for minimally invasive pain management devices in Japan is primarily driven by demographic and lifestyle-related factors. With over 28 percent of the population aged 65 and above, Japan has one of the highest elderly populations in the world. This demographic is more prone to chronic pain conditions, including osteoarthritis, lower back pain, and degenerative spinal disorders, necessitating effective pain management solutions. Additionally, Japan’s healthcare policies prioritize reducing hospital stays and promoting outpatient care, further driving the adoption of minimally invasive techniques.
The increasing prevalence of work-related musculoskeletal disorders and sports injuries also contributes to market growth. As awareness about the long-term effects of chronic pain increases, patients and healthcare providers are actively seeking alternatives to opioid-based pain management. Technological advancements in pain management devices, such as bioelectronic medicine and non-invasive neuromodulation, are further fueling the market’s expansion. Additionally, the integration of artificial intelligence and smart pain management solutions is expected to shape the future of the industry in Japan.

Regulatory Landscape and Market Challenges
Despite its growth potential, the market for minimally invasive pain management devices in Japan is not without challenges. The regulatory approval process for medical devices in Japan is stringent, requiring compliance with the Pharmaceuticals and Medical Devices Act (PMDA) and obtaining certifications from the Ministry of Health, Labour and Welfare (MHLW). These regulations ensure patient safety but can also result in prolonged product approval timelines, posing a barrier for new market entrants.
Another challenge is the cost-sensitive nature of the Japanese healthcare system. While there is high demand for pain management solutions, pricing pressures from government healthcare policies and insurance reimbursements can limit profit margins. Businesses must focus on cost optimization and value-based pricing strategies to remain competitive. Additionally, local consumer preferences for proven and well-documented technologies mean that market education and awareness campaigns are crucial for introducing new products.
